Subject: Lift maintenance this Saturday

Facilities — quick heads-up from the front desk at Brindlemark House. Lift cars A and B are down for servicing Saturday 06:00–13:00. Engineers from Qorvel Vertical arrive at 05:45; please have the plant room unlocked. All weekend foot traffic goes via the south stairwell. Signage is already posted in the lobby. Escort any confused visitors to the stairwell door yourselves if needed. The stairwell keypad is active all weekend, so use the code noted below.

badge for fawep-bahop: bdg-EWZVI-26220

## Local Setup

Heads up: Fennelworks partitions the events table by month, so your local Postgres needs the partition bootstrap script run first (`make partitions`). Otherwise inserts just vanish into the void and you'll blame the app. Seed data covers the last three months. Once partitions exist, point your local instance at the dev database using the string below.

primary connection of yagep-kahip = redis://giliel_svc:zYiKsLL2PLpfPL@db-348f.xolmarsys.corp:5432/fenwyn

Runbook: rounding drift in Quillden currency conversion. Symptom: ledger totals off by sub-cent amounts after batch conversion. Cause: per-line rounding instead of rounding the summed minor units. Fix is deployed; this fragment covers verification. Run the reconciliation job, compare drift counter to zero, and check that the banker's-rounding mode is active in every region. If drift persists, restart the converter workers and re-run. The converter must be running with the configuration values printed below.

settings of bawif-fawif:
ralix:
  log_level: warn
  metrics_host: metrics.ralix.tolvaqsys.internal
  pool_size: 32